#include "object.h"
#include "object.cpp"
//#include <windows.h>
int main() {
string menuChoice;
solarSystem* currentSystem = NULL;
listOfSystems* systemList = new listOfSystems;
initializeSystemList(systemList);
while(menuChoice != "quit"){
//Sleep( 500 );
cout << "\nWhat would you like to do?\n 1. Create a new Solar System\n 2. Add a new object to current System\n 3. View objects in current System\n 4. Change current System\n" <<endl;
cin >> menuChoice;
switch (atoi(menuChoice.c_str())) {
case 1:
{
string solarSystemName;
cout << "\nSolar System name: ";
cin >> solarSystemName;
solarSystem* newSolarSystem = createSolarSystem(systemList, solarSystemName);
currentSystem = newSolarSystem; //to hold the system the user is currently using
cout << "\nNew solar system created:\n\n";
cout << "Name: " << newSolarSystem->name << " \n";
cout << "Size: " << newSolarSystem->numberOfBodies << " bodies\n";
cout << "Total Mass: " << newSolarSystem->totalMass << " kg \n";
cout << "Center of Mass: " << newSolarSystem->centerOfMass << " meters \n\n";
break;
}
case 2:
{
if (currentSystem == NULL) {
cout << "\nYou don't have any solar systems!\n\n";
break;
}
float mass, radius, xPosition;
string name;
cout << "\nWhat is the name of your object? ";
cin >> name;
cout << "What is the radius of your object? ";
cin >> radius;
cout << "What is the mass of your object? ";
cin >> mass;
cout << "What is the x-position of your object? ";
cin >> xPosition;
celestialBody *newCelestialBody = createCelestialBody(mass, radius, xPosition, name);
addBodyToSystem(newCelestialBody, currentSystem);
cout << "\nObject added:\n\n" << newCelestialBody->name;
cout << "\nRadius: " << newCelestialBody->radius << " meters\n";
cout << "Mass: " << newCelestialBody->mass << " kg\n";
cout << "x-position: " << newCelestialBody->xPosition << " meters\n\n";
break;
}
case 3:
if (currentSystem == NULL) {
cout << "\nYou don't have any solar systems!\n\n";
break;
}
if (currentSystem->numberOfBodies == 0) {
cout << "\nYour system is empty!\n\n";
break;
}
solarSystemPrint(currentSystem);
break;
case 4:
if (currentSystem == NULL) {
cout << "\nYou don't have any solar systems!\n\n";
break;
}
cout << "\nChange to:" << endl;
currentSystem = selectSystem(systemList);
cout << "\nThe current system is now " << currentSystem->name << endl;
break;
default:
if (menuChoice != "quit")
cout << "\nNot a valid option!\n\n";
break;
}
}
cout << "Goodbye!";
}
